  6. Well, sadly, when I got my Volks, somepone at the factory in Japan forgot to put one in the box. So when I bought them and turned up at the fitters, we only had 3 stem valves. Tony @ Envy, then made a trip round to find a valve and found a truck/lorry valve. it was identical to the ones Volk supplied, only difference has the rubber o-ring, but that only needed a little trimming to fit. So short aswer: Yes, it 100% fit and worked for me

  18. Hi there from a fellow blade silver owner. It all depends how far you want to go to be honest. AutoGlym (AG) is pretty good stuff and if you don't want more than just a regular clean, then nothing more will be needed. What I and others may suggest is that you use the "Two Bucket Method" for washing, unless you do that already. A few of us, including myself use snowfoam and other wonderous products for cleaning. You could look into using a claybar twice a year, regular polish and waxing, to keep the shine tip top.
